I’ve still been reading plenty of books, just not posting about them. Sorry! Anyway, I wanted to post about Debbie Harry Sings in French, a YA novel about a punky straight, yet cross-dressing teen boy. His girlfriend Maria helps him cross dress as his idol, Debbie Harry and it is a fun and touching book. Much recommended!
I also just finished reading The Heebie-Jeebies at CBGBs: A Secret History of Jewish Punk, which has a lot of interesting info about the history of NY punk covering people like Lou Reed, The Dictators, The Ramones, and much more. I found it very interesting and it also gets into Jewish American history a bit. Also recommended!

Friday, January 16th, 2009This group show is up from Jan. 16-18 and includes pieces by comics folks such as myself, Matt Loux, and Richard Sala among many others. The theme is obscure mythical creatures and the artists were forbidden to research them visually, so they are drawn purely from imagination.
